Programme Overview

Efficiency alone is no longer enough. As AI takes over transactional and operational decisions, supply chain leaders are expected to drive resilience, sustainability, and long-term value creation.

This programme prepares you to lead in an era shaped by climate accountability, regulatory scrutiny, and global disruption. You will gain practical frameworks to address challenges such as Scope 3 emissions, responsible sourcing, and regenerative supply chain design, while strengthening your ability to influence stakeholders and deliver measurable business impact.

Eligibility Criteria

  • Education: Graduation (3 years) from a recognized university
  • Experience: Minimum 3 years of professional experience.
  • Current Role: Mid- to senior-level Supply Chain Management professionals or equivalent roles.

Assessment Criteria

  • Class Participation
  • In-Class Exercises
  • Group Project

Attendance

  • Minimum 80% attendance is mandatory.
